Financial and contractual agreements are safer when you have a guarantee. This is the safety net you require to recover your money in case the agreement is not honored. A standby letter of credit is a perfect guarantee when handling project and transactions of any magnitude. It helps you avoid reliance on goodwill when doing business.

This form of security is used in such industries as construction, shipment and service delivery. The giver promises to make payments in case the terms of the deal are not fulfilled. The best parties to give such a commitment at the international level are financial institutions or firms operating in both jurisdictions where this transaction is being carried out.

As a beneficiary, you will not suffer any loss in case the contractor fails to deliver the goods, complete a project or meet certain conditions. The banker has evaluated the creditworthiness of the contractor and identified his ceiling. The assumption is that this contractor will make payments to the bank after it releases the money to you.

A perfect example is a contractor working in Dubai. The project is supposed to be completed within a set time frame. The letter of credit is issued as a guarantee that the deadline will be met. When this does not happen, the client collects money from the guarantor as compensation for lost time and revenue. This money is used to cover for the cost of hiring another contractor or loss of business.

The letters are cushions against breached trust. There are reasons why the contractor may fail to pay in case the transaction or project does not go as planned. He is likely to be waiting for his customers to pay him and is therefore facing a financial crunch. You are assured that you have a buffer for your finances and projects.

Your contractor or supplier is likely to have gone out of business. This makes it difficult to attach his assets and force him to refund or reimburse your money. Banks have the legal mandate to attach properties of their creditors. As a client, this could be a lengthy process or you do not have the mandate. It is easier for banks to recover monies in case of default.

The assets of your contractor or supplier may be frozen because of political unrest. There are disagreements that may arise midway through the project and cause it to stall. Such circumstances would make it difficult to recover your funds. This is also the best way to deal with dishonest contractors who have no intention of fulfilling their contractual agreements.

There are conditions set by banks to facilitate payment. The client must proof that certain conditions were breached and thus the situation warrants compensation. A standby letter is not used unless the need arises, which is in extreme cases.
